Trimming Kitten Claws

Getting your kitten comfortable with having his paws handled can help prevent hook-trimming drama as he gets older.

As kittens grow, they discover all their fighting tools, including their nails. They as well discover how much fun it is to climb piece of furniture and bat at toys. But what they really need to discover is how to accept yous cutting their nails so you lot can help protect them from the hurting of overgrown nails and prevent damage to your furniture and flesh.


Kittens normally have their claws retracted so they have some control over whether they are scratching. But don't count on training your kitten to go along his claws retracted — yous'll accept ameliorate luck clipping his nails every few weeks.

Accustom your kitten to lying on his dorsum in your lap facing you or in some other position that is comfy and calming for him. You can start when he's sleepy and give him some treats for remaining still for increasingly longer periods. Practise property each mitt in your hand, rewarding him for being cooperative. Then gently press on the tops of each toe until the claw is exposed. Again, requite him treats for being good.


Finally, afterward several days (at least) of such practice, information technology's time to clip his get-go nail. For a kitten, you can employ human fingernail clippers or small blast trimmers made for pets. Just make sure they're precipitous, as boring clippers can beat out the blast, which may exist painful. For now, but cut off the very tip of each nail. Avoid the pinkish quick y'all can run across within the nail. The quick contains both claret and nerve supplies to the smash, so be prepared for a bit of haemorrhage and protesting if yous cut it. Just don't panic. Stop the haemorrhage with some styptic pulverization, and if you don't have that, you can utilize flour or cornstarch. Make sure to repent with treats and promises not to slip up again!

Requite a treat after each blast and don't feel you lot have to cut them all this first time. It's better to terminate before your kitten starts struggling than to push button things to that point. Instead, requite him a interruption and practise a few more nails subsequently. Just remember which ones you lot've already washed! Cats have five toes (and v claws) per forepart human foot and four toes (and 4 claws) per dorsum human foot — although polydactyl cats can have many more. One of the nails on each front paw is actually up on the wrist, so don't overlook information technology.


When your kitten learns early on that smash trimming can be a positive and rewarding experience, he'll be more than likely to cooperate with it subsequently on in life. Information technology's also important to provide your kitten with scratching posts or platforms and then that he learns to sharpen his nails there, rather than on your furniture.
